Another week, another nod to the power of brands and creators connecting with customers and followers in real life on the How I Built This podcast. 

This time round, Julia Hartz, the co-founder and CEO of Eventbrite, kicks off the show with host Guy talking about how events and activations are a growing part of wider marketing strategies… 

Julia; Our research shows that pretty much every Gen Z’er, 98%, says that they want to extend their relationship with a product or a story that they love in real life.

Bringing the niche communities into real life and creating that connection between identity & community that’s cultivated online to a real life situation offline, helps people build. We see this as only continuing to grow with the advent of this community building that’s not about the technology or online space, but it’s actually about the nucleus of that community and the strength of that. 

Guy adds an insight into his own experience; It’s really special to have that [in person] connection, you know sometimes I’m like ah shall we do it it’s so much work, it’s a lot. Then you do it and your like that was great. That was awesome.
